Land for sale in Lower Rangemore, Bulawayo High-Density, offers affordable options with an average price of $65,600. The median land size is around 250 ㎡, with some larger plots reaching up to 330,000 ㎡, providing a variety of choices for buyers looking for budget-friendly land in an urban setting.
These land properties are typically suited for residential or small-scale commercial use, reflecting the vibrant and dynamic nature of the neighborhood. The area is known for its lively community atmosphere and mix of housing options, making it attractive for working-class families and young professionals.
Lower Rangemore benefits from convenient access to essential amenities such as several primary and secondary schools, public health clinics, and the nearby Mpilo Central Hospital. Residents enjoy proximity to cultural sites like the Bulawayo Railway Museum and recreational areas including Hillside Dams Recreational Park. The neighborhood is well served by public transport and main roads, with local markets and larger shopping centers like Hillside Shopping Centre and Bulawayo City Centre within easy reach, supporting a practical and connected lifestyle.
